300
A shortage of nurses occurred during what decade? (a. the 1930s b. the 1950s c. the 1980s d. the 1990s) Also, what attributed to this shortage?
What the 1980s? Various answers: Long hours, low pay. Problem was fixed by making Nursing a more attractive occupation with better pay, benefits, working conditions, and incentives.

400
In 1965 the American Nursing Association required nurses should be graduates of college programs. What were some of the results of this?
Various: Since most nurses were from diploma schools at the time, most of the work force was alienated. This weakened the ANA as a voice for nurses.
